Output d7104ddf23e8f35d163833d3ace4f72b32f22643b2df5274a722cf4c30d0c2fe:3

value
57634834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1dea5a43af634e42548c5f2121291ce1961a5e6 OP_EQUAL
address
MT2rBJwQnk5Zgr7cjW8eBmGg9LX5bdpEX3
transaction
d7104ddf23e8f35d163833d3ace4f72b32f22643b2df5274a722cf4c30d0c2fe
spent
true